Based on the provided diagram and steps outlined earlier, the formula for converting the Gigabits per Hour (Gbit/Hr) to Megabytes per Second (MBps) can be expressed as follows:

diamond CONVERSION FORMULA MBps = Gbit/Hr x 1000 ÷ 8 / ( 60 x 60 )

Now, let's apply the aforementioned formula and explore the manual conversion process from Gigabits per Hour (Gbit/Hr) to Megabytes per Second (MBps). To streamline the calculation further, we can simplify the formula for added convenience.

FORMULA

Megabytes per Second = Gigabits per Hour x 1000 ÷ 8 / ( 60 x 60 )

STEP 1

Megabytes per Second = Gigabits per Hour x 125 / ( 60 x 60 )

STEP 2

Megabytes per Second = Gigabits per Hour x 125 / 3600

STEP 3

Megabytes per Second = Gigabits per Hour x 0.0347222222222222222222222222222222222125

Unit Definitions

What is Gigabit ?

A Gigabit (Gb or Gbit) is a decimal unit of digital information that is equal to 1,000,000,000 bits and it is commonly used to express data transfer speeds, such as the speed of an internet connection and to measure the size of a file. In the context of data storage and memory, the binary-based unit of gibibit (Gibit) is used instead.

What is Megabyte ?

A Megabyte (MB) is a decimal unit of digital information that is equal to 1,000,000 bytes (or 8,000,000 bits) and commonly used to express the size of a file or the amount of memory used by a program. It is also used to express data transfer speeds and in the context of data storage and memory, the binary-based unit of mebibyte (MiB) is used instead.
